Git, SourceTree, ветки и несколько пользователей.
На работе возникла ситуация, что немного запутались с ветками в системе контроля версий. Несколько разработчиков, несколько тестировщиков и масса пользователей, которым эти разборки глубоко фиолетово. Необходимость такой "шпаргалки" встала в полный рост.
Далее
git-клиенты для Windows
В продолжение статей по рассмотрению git- и svn-клиентов для Windows... Так сказать, подводя некоторые итоги
Далее
Системы контроля версий и клиенты для Windows: GIT и GitExtension
GIT и GitExtension
Далее
Системы контроля версий и клиенты для Windows: GIT и SourceTree
GIT и SourceTree
Далее
Системы контроля версий и клиенты для Windows: TortoiseSVN
SVN и TortoiseSVN
Далее
Системы контроля версий и клиенты для Windows
Памятуя о статье Коротко о системе контроля версий и подозревая, что самому масса вещей еще понадобится, за две недели нарисовал этот текст. Сначала думал сделать одну большую статью, но объем такой статьи получился запредельным (больше 5 метров со всеми картинками), поэтому разбил на несколько кусочков.
Получился небольшой цикл из 4 статей (включая эту), посвященный работе с 3 клиентами cvs: TortoiseSVN, SourceTree и GitExtensions. Разбирался с ними по русскому принципу - т.е. инструкцию начинал читать только когда понимал что "все, звездец, сломал". Так что особо строго не судите
Далее
Коротко о системе контроля версий
Так сложилась ситуация, что у меня вечно все проекты достаточно разветвленные и не совсем простые. Длятся они не днями, а неделями (а то и годами ;)). Практически неизбежна ситуация, когда сегодня ненужный и / или неудачный код станет жизненно необходимым через полгода. Вроде бы и делал, но гарантированно стер.
Нередки ситуации, когда требования конечного потребителя меняются (вплоть до того, что надо восстанавливать исходное положение дел).
В общем и целом - надо хранить историю создания / изменения. Вот об истории и развитии этого дела я и хотел бы поговорить.
Далее